What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Client Onboarding Specialist (Remote), and why are they important?

To thrive as a Client Onboarding Specialist (Remote), you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a background in customer service or account management, often supported by a bachelor’s degree. Familiarity with CRM software like Salesforce, onboarding platforms, and virtual communication tools is typically required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ving abilities, and the capacity to build rapport remotely are standout soft skills. These competencies ensure smooth client transitions, high satisfaction, and effective collaboration in a distributed work environment.

What are some common challenges faced when working in a remote client onboarding role, and how can they be overcome?

In a remote client onboarding role, communication and relationship-building can be more challenging without in-person interactions. It's important to proactively schedule video meetings, use clear written communication, and leverage collaborative tools to ensure clients feel supported throughout the process. Staying organized, setting clear expectations, and following up regularly with both clients and internal teams help prevent misunderstandings and ensure a smooth onboarding experience.

What does a Client Onboarding Remote professional do?

A Client Onboarding Remote professional is responsible for guiding new clients through the initial setup and integration process with a company’s products or services, all while working remotely. They ensure that clients have a smooth transition, understand how to use the offerings, and address any questions or concerns. Their role often involves virtual meetings, documentation, and ongoing support to foster strong client relationships and satisfaction from a distance.

Client Onboarding Remote focuses on guiding new clients through initial setup and integration, ensuring a smooth start. Customer Success Specialists maintain ongoing relationships, helping clients maximize product value. While onboarding is a part of customer success, the roles differ in scope and focus, with onboarding being more project-specific and customer success emphasizing long-term retention and satisfaction.
